Coordinator, Digital Marketing/ Social MediaA little bit about our team:The Digital team at 300 Elektra Entertainment is a full-service, agency-like marketing team, dedicated to building artist careers through the intersection of music and technology. They are responsible for all digital strategy and marketing for all artists on the roster, acting as artist partners in our 360 relationships, across music, touring, merch, and all other aspects of the artist career. Through creative marketing campaigns, they build online fan communities, with an eye towards evolving the way that fans listen to, participate in, and purchase music and related products. They create, market, distribute and optimize content, develop and implement CRM/fan acquisition strategies, and work with new, engaging digital platforms and startups. Your role:The Digital & Social Media Coordinator directly to the Senior Vice President of Digital Marketing and is the primary role in supporting the artists and label's social media strategy and executing the promotion of new releases weekly across social media accounts. The Digital + Social Media coordinator works with the Creative, Digital and Marketing teams to manage and execute release and artist-related content, label-related and newsworthy content being posted on label and artists' social accounts. Within the role, you will work on reaching thousands of music fans by creating social posts across Instagram, TikTok, Twitter, Facebook, YouTube Community and Triller. Here you'll be able to support priority releases of some of the best and biggest artists. You will have the opportunity to be creative, ideating new social content for artist and label as you engage a multitude of fan bases across all genres. You'll also brainstorm digital marketing strategies and campaigns, stay up-to-date with current trends, and establish a fluency within social media platforms.The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, and able to multi-task as you will be juggling the social media marketing of a multitude of releases. This person is interested in promotion online with innovative digital campaigns AND has an interest in new technology. They read blogs every day, installs every new app just to try it out, and has a passion for leveraging the Internet to drive artist careers and revenue. They live on social media, lifestyle blogs, and discovers new music in interesting ways. You MUST be highly creative, extremely motivated, and love being a part of a team. Here you'll get to:
